Filip & Mathilde in Washington, April 18th
Here's the information from the official site, as Mette pointed out:
Visit to Washington. The princes will take part in a conference that unites diplomatic, consulair and economic agents from Belgium in the US. They will attend a work meeting at the World Bank.
Prince Filip will also be present at a meeting of the board of direction of the king Boudewijn fund-USA, and at a remembrance ceremony for the 60th anniversary of the liberation.
Princess Mathilde will speak at a forum on micocredit at Georgetown University and will visit the Gallaudet University for deaf students.

Mathilde will visit Georgetown University today and speak at a conference on Microfinance:
In honor of the United Nations' International Year of Microcredit, Georgetown University hosts a half-day conference exploring the future, challenges and innovations in microfinance. A joint effort between students of the McDonough School of Business, Edmund A. Walsh School of Foreign Service and Georgetown Public Policy Institute, the conference aims to connect students and policymakers in an educational forum about the field of microfinance. Events begin at 1:00 p.m. on Tuesday April 19, 2005 in Georgetown's ICC Auditorium.
...The conference will conclude with remarks from Her Royal Highness, Princess Mathilde of Belgium, Emissary to the International Year of Microcredit.

Mathilde will visit Gallaudet University on April 21:
Belgium Princess Mathilde to visit campus - Princess Mathilde of Belgium will pay a short visit to campus this Thursday, April 21.
- The princess is the wife of the Belgium crown prince and future king, who is in Washington to meet with President Bush and other leaders.
- Princess Mathilde will meet students, have lunch with President and Mrs. Jordan in House One, observe a class and receive a brief tour of campus.
- More about the royal visit will be in On the Green.

Princess Mathilde spoke at the University of Georgetown on the UN initiative for Microcredit, which aims to to build support for making financial services more accessible to poor and low income people. Afterwards, she along with Prince Philippe walked the streets of the university.
